Framed Print of Great Eastern Railways Locomotive works at Stratford

A view along the north side of the Great Eastern Railway?s Locomotive works at Stratford (East London). May 1864 with William Henry Maw, then Head of the Drawing office, seated on the axle of a carriage or wagon wheel set, with his colleague James Kitson further back. In the background is The Railway Tavern public house (which is still extant) and dwellings in the Angel Place area. Date: 1864.
